Citizens asked to help with Mayors’ Christmas Motorcade

For 51 years, cities across Georgia have brought the joy of the holiday season to patients at Georgia’s seven regional mental health and retardation hospitals through the Mayors’ Christmas Motorcade.

The program relies on citizens in each city to donate gifts for the patients, many of whom would not receive gifts or be recognized without the Mayors’ Christmas Motorcade. Many of the patients at these hospitals have lived there most of their lives and have little, if any, support or contact with friends and family.

Donated items from the city of Dalton will be delivered to the Northwest Georgia Regional Hospital in Rome on Dec. 15. Civic organizations, businesses, churches, schools, scout troops and individual citizens are encouraged to help with the collection of gifts for the Mayors’ Christmas Motorcade.
